### What Are Incline Push-Ups?
Incline push-ups are a variation of the classic push-up exercise that involves elevating the hands to a higher surface than the feet. By changing the angle of the body, incline push-ups reduce the percentage of body weight that needs to be lifted, making them more accessible for beginners or individuals with limited upper body strength. However, don't mistake their reduced difficulty for ineffectiveness. Incline push-ups still provide a challenging workout that targets the chest, shoulders, and arms.
### How to Perform Incline Push-Ups:
Performing incline push-ups is relatively straightforward, and they can be done almost anywhere with an elevated surface.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to execute them properly:
1. **Find an Elevated Surface:**
Locate a sturdy surface that is elevated off the ground, such as a bench, sturdy chair, or even a staircase.
2. **Assume the Push-Up Position:**
Stand facing the elevated surface and place your hands slightly wider than shoulder-width apart on the surface. Extend your arms fully, keeping your body in a straight line from head to heels.
3. **Position Your Feet:**
Step back with your feet until your body forms a diagonal line. Your feet should be hip-width apart, and your toes should be touching the ground.
4. **Engage Your Core:**
Tighten your abdominal muscles to stabilize your torso throughout the exercise.
5. **Lower Your Body:**
Bend your elbows and lower your chest towards the elevated surface while keeping your body in a straight line. Aim to lower yourself until your chest almost touches the surface.
6. **Push Back Up:**
Once you've reached the lowest point, push through your palms to straighten your arms and return to the starting position.
7. **Repeat:**
Complete the desired number of repetitions, focusing on maintaining proper form throughout the exercise.

### Incorporating Incline Push-Ups Into Your Routine:
To reap the confidence-boosting benefits of incline push-ups, consider incorporating them into your regular workout routine. Here are some tips for getting started:
1. **Start Gradually:** Begin with a modest incline, such as a bench or elevated platform, and gradually increase the difficulty as you build strength and confidence.
2. **Focus on Form:** Pay close attention to maintaining proper form throughout each repetition. This not only maximizes the effectiveness of the exercise but also reduces the risk of injury.
3. **Track Your Progress:** Keep a record of your incline push-up workouts, including the number of reps, sets, and the height of the incline. Tracking your progress provides tangible evidence of improvement and helps you set realistic goals.
4. **Combine with Other Exercises:** Incorporate incline push-ups into a comprehensive upper body workout routine that includes a variety of exercises targeting different muscle groups.
5. **Be Consistent:** Consistency is key to achieving lasting results. Aim to perform incline push-ups regularly, gradually increasing the intensity and challenging yourself to push beyond your comfort zone.
